RUSTY S. & PITTI BLUE I-IV by MRZB
RUSTY S. & PITTI BLUE I-IV is a one-act multimedia performance in eight fragments performed by a spectral cast of objects, sculptures and costumes activated by a sound and light score. The piece relies on a frantic layering of text, sculptures, costumes, recorded music, tape and paper collages, actions and gestures, horizontally sequenced spaces, blaring screens and performed images. The protagonists are RUSTY S. & PITTI BLUE, two death-like-mechanical puppets, sculpturally crafted from a mosaic of found and residual materials scattered by a blaze at the Baraccopoli di Lungo Stura Lazio, Turin.
An audience of mannequins, retrieved from past works, is cut into pieces and fiberglassed back together in Frankenstein-like anthropomorphic shapes: their sleep interrupted by fifteen minutes of feverish dreams, spiraling them out of their bodies in psychedelic scenettes set between ‘’the stage’’,
a wall of projection and two collages. Power plays, spleens, and lullabies are mixed and merged as allegories to the age of total anesthesia.
